GrantStation vs Instrumentl
GrantStation and Instrumentl both sit in Grant research. GrantStation: ~$199/yr. Instrumentl: From $299/mo billed annually ($3,588/yr). The table below lines up pricing model and fit, each in the product's own terms, so you can see which one matches your shop.

| GrantStation | Instrumentl | |
|---|---|---|
| Entry price | ~$199/yr | From $299/mo billed annually ($3,588/yr) |
| Pricing model | Flat annual membership; TechSoup and seasonal discounts | Tiered by user seats; 14-day free trial |
| Best for | Budget-conscious shops that want a broad funder database and will run their own searches | Shops managing 10+ grant applications that want matching and deadline tracking in one place |
| Last verified | Aug 2026 | Aug 2026 |
GrantStation
Strengths: Among the cheapest paid entries into funder research at the TechSoup price; Covers private, corporate, and government funders in one database; Weekly funding alerts arrive without extra effort.

Instrumentl
Strengths: Active matching surfaces funders you would not find by keyword search; Deadline and reporting tracker replaces the spreadsheet most teams limp along on; 990 and giving-history data sit next to each funder.
